We are looking for a Compensation Analyst to join our team in contributing to the development and implementation of region-wide compensation strategies, practices and processes. In this role, you'll play a key part in managing and evolving compensation programs by leveraging data, market insights, and cross-functional collaboration to drive informed decision-making. You'll partner closely with stakeholders across HR, Finance, and business teams to deliver analytics, streamline processes, and support year-end and ongoing compensation cycles. This is a highly dynamic opportunity for someone who enjoys balancing hands-on analytics with program management in a fast-paced, ever-evolving environment.
Responsibilities: - Project management of company wide compensation programs
- Defining and documenting project plans, work flows.
- Provide analytics support for compensation programs as needed
- Provide communications support for compensation programs
- Special projects involving data analytics
- Partnering with comp team to align on projects/global initiatives
- Providing improvement insights using improvement methodologies and tools
QualificationsBasic Qualifications: - BA/BS degree in related field
- 2+ years of program/project management ideally in compensation
Preferred Qualifications: - Knowledge of MS Office (Outlook, Word, PowerPoint and Excel)
- Thorough communication, interpersonal and analytical skills
- Project/Program management skills
- Ability to communicate effectively with all levels of the organization
- Ability to quickly learn and adopt new technologies and software
- Ability to effectively manage time, prioritize tasks and work within deadlines with little supervision
- Ability to work in a fast-paced, startup environment
